What is social engineering in the context of cybersecurity?
- A.Building secure network infrastructure
- B.Manipulating people psychologically to trick them into giving up information or access
- C.Using social media for marketing purposes
- D.Programming bots to interact on social media
Why B is correct
Social engineering exploits human psychology rather than technical vulnerabilities. Attackers manipulate people through deception, urgency, fear, or trust to obtain sensitive information, gain unauthorized access, or trick victims into performing actions that compromise security. It is one of the most effective attack methods.
